Subsequent seasons have aired on the same April to June/July schedule every year since the original 2005 season, with more recent seasons airing until August/September.Įpisodes Season 1 (2005) No. The first season consisted of ten episodes, with the finale airing on June 14, 2005. The show's title derives from the inherent high risk of injury or death associated with the work.ĭeadliest Catch premiered on the Discovery Channel on April 12, 2005, and the show currently airs worldwide. The Aleutian Islands port of Dutch Harbor, Alaska, is the base of operations for the fishing fleet. It portrays the real life events aboard fishing vessels in the Bering Sea during the Alaskan king crab, bairdi crab, and opilio crab fishing seasons.
Deadliest Catch is a documentary television series produced by Original Productions for the Discovery Channel.
